Output bb2729d39b1fbb75035098ba33fcec3ea55868495d96b3eaeb59ea23bb9c7ca9:21

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 110d079661f1ebb9c84be2596d943298f77c2807 OP_EQUAL
address
33FB27uzjjdndTxxoyL38HKFiKg1mHb5UU
transaction
bb2729d39b1fbb75035098ba33fcec3ea55868495d96b3eaeb59ea23bb9c7ca9
confirmations
204408
spent
true